What are some of the cultural influences in contemporary Morocco?

What will be an ideal response?


• Morocco is part of the contemporary Arab world, but also shows a French presence since Morocco only became independent form France in 1956. (Maghrebi culture is likewise a notable cultural feature of France.)
• Morocco's proximity to Europe has made the country more accessible to Westerners than other more remote countries of the Arab world (e.g., Syria, or Saudi Arabia). "Following independence, the country became a magnet for counterculture musicians [and writers]" (e.g., Ornette Colman, the Rolling Stones, Timothy Leary)
• North African music and musicians are being introduced to an international fan base.
